Output dc580fb71ebc3c66d4341390ffc59ccacb0452df5276a7da1a573f7c4a6f3867:5

value
18300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f03a3f5bb3cfa6f4239a6067a1138d3b94981b1 OP_EQUALVERIFY OP_CHECKSIG
address
1B7zNEmSij5vN3Lcw8ZDVSetKmobfZLdf1
transaction
dc580fb71ebc3c66d4341390ffc59ccacb0452df5276a7da1a573f7c4a6f3867
spent
true